APPOINTMENT OF MR MAHESH FAKIR to THE SANRAL BOARD

SANRAL wishes to notify debt investors that the Minister of Transport, Ms. Barbara Creecy, has
appointed Mr. Mahesh Fakir to the SANRAL Board as a non-executive director. Mr. Fakir is replacing
Mr. Errol Makhubela, whose term expired on 2 July 2024, following his nomination by the Minister
of Finance. This appointment is made in accordance with section 12(2)(c) of the South African
National Roads Agency Limited and National Roads Act, 1998 (Act No. 7 of 1998). The appointment
is effective from 22 August 2024 for a duration of three (3) years.


Mahesh Fakir is a highly experienced professional with a robust background in civil engineering,
finance, and public sector management. He has held key leadership roles, including CEO of the Ports
Regulator of South Africa and currently serves as a consultant for Operation Vulindlela under the
Presidency. His career spans over three decades, marked by significant contributions to
infrastructure development, public finance, and strategic governance in South Africa. Mahesh is
recognized for his expertise in project management, regulatory frameworks, and fostering economic
growth through structural reforms.
